About Mike Taschuk

G2V Optics is an emerging global leader in smart, precision lighting and is committed to creating enabling technologies to power & feed the world of tomorrow. G2V currently provides technology solutions to world-leading researchers, Fortune 500 technology firms, and aerospace companies in over 35 countries. G2V sells several solar simulation product lines globally and enables our customers to develop solutions for a more sustainable built-world. Our customers use G2V's photons to drive the most critical developments in solar renewable energy, high efficiency food production, reliable advanced materials, and space exploration of this decade and beyond. Across the value chain of each of these sectors, highly reliable lighting is needed to develop, manufacture, process, and test the devices and outputs in each case. Our software-controlled Engineered Sunlight™ technology acts as a foundation to replicate geography-, season-, and altitude-specific natural lighting environments, as well as create light which matches the spectrum, uniformity, and stability requirements of scientific standards.

  • University Of Alberta
    Research Associate
    University Of Alberta Jan 2009 - Dec 2015
    Edmonton, Ab, Ca
    I lead a research team on a five-year industrial research chair program for Micralyne, Inc.We are developing nanostructured thin film technologies for gas sensing, organic solar cell,and chromatography applications. I have worked with undergraduate, M.Sc., Ph.D. andpost-doctoral researchers during all aspects of their projects.• Provisional patent: method for producing branched nanowires US61/730206• Provisional patent (preparing): manufacturing method for nanostructured thin films• Co-invented 1” diameter fluorescence spectrometer for ConeTec, Inc.• Designed and tested solar cell characterization tool suite: calibrated solar simulator, external quantum efficiency tester, and relative humidity and temperature controlled environmental chamber with online radiometric spectral monitoring• Developed gas sensor technology for Micralyne, Inc.: characterized and improved response time, sensitivity, lifetime and specificity (developed technique to simultaneouslyidentify and quantify multiple analytes using a single nanostructured sensor element)• Developed nanostructured chromatography plates that are 10 times faster than commercial equivalents, requiring design, implementation and testing of time-resolved chromatography video system and data analysis software• Programmed nanowire thin film growth simulator using Unreal development kit• Co-wrote two successful grant proposals worth $425,000 per year ($2.1M over 5 years)• Led research group to record total productivity (18 papers) in the 2010–2011 academicyear, and record per-capita productivity (14 total, 1.4 per student) in 2012-2013• Published 33 peer-reviewed articles and 5 conference proceedings
  • University Of Alberta
    Nserc Post Doctoral Fellow
    University Of Alberta Jan 2007 - Dec 2008
    Edmonton, Ab, Ca
    Researched optical and sensor applications of nanostructured thin films. Collaborated withPh.D. students on their research projects.• Developed anti-aging protocol for relative humidity sensor technology, extending lifetime from 48 hours to 100 days, allowing Schneider Electric to evaluate technology• Engineered nanostructure which controlled thin film angular light emission profiles• Programmed Jacobi elliptic integral functions for open source mpmath Python module• Published 9 peer-reviewed journal articles, 1 book chapter, 6 conference proceedings
  • University Of Alberta
    Ph.D. Student
    University Of Alberta May 2000 - Dec 2006
    Edmonton, Ab, Ca
    Thesis work on laser-induced breakdown spectroscopy (LIBS), quantifying the LIBS process and reducing energy requirements to faciliate design of portable LIBS systems.Thesis title: Quantification of laser-induced breakdown spectroscopy at low energies.• Led a simultaneous collaboration with two competing spectrophotometer vendors, comparing absolute instrumental performance of new products in a common publication• Developed forensic technique for non-destructive fingerprint analysis, resulting in a consultation visit by a Japanese team of forensic scientists• Won national scholarships at M.Sc., Ph.D and post-doctoral levels• Published 8 peer-reviewed articles, 1 book chapter, and 9 conference proceedings
